איך קזינו מחבר בין ספקים חיים דרך גשר
מהו גשר בהקשר של קזינו חי
Bridge היא שכבה בין הפלטפורמה של המפעיל לספקי חיים (אבולוציה, פרגמטי לייב, אזוגי, TVBET וכו ') המנטרלת אפליקציה, אירועים, רישום וחישובים פיננסיים. במילים פשוטות, ברידג 'עושה תריסר אינטגרציות שונות ”זהות” לכאורה: חוזה הימורים יחיד, תוכנית סטטוס עגולה אחת, קורות רשת מונוטוניות ודיווח.
למה זה נחוץ?
חוזה יחיד לעשרות ספקים (פחות שינויים בפלטפורמה).
אידמפוטנטיות והגנה מפני טייקים (מגשים מחדש, מחברים מחדש שחקן).
נורמליזציה קטלוגית (שולחנות, גבולות, הימורים צדדיים, מקומות).
שולחן מזומנים בודד וכללי סיכון (גבולות, AML/KYT, RG).
ניטור זרם QOS ו SLA על ידי ספק.
שרשרת רכיבים
1. פלטפורמת קזינו (מארח): חשבונות, KYC/RG, בונוסים, ארנק, קדמי.
2. גשר: מתאם אספקה, אוטובוס אירועים, מיפוי שולחן/הגבלה, חשבונאות פיננסית, כריתת עצים, פינות אינטרנט.
3. Live-Divide: זרם (בדרך כלל WebRTC/HLS), מנוע משחק, חישוב תוצאות, סוחרים.
4. ארנק: Seamless (מאזן מאוחסן על ידי המפעיל) או Transfer (הפקדה לבנק המשחק מהספק).
5. תצפיות: מדדי זרם (FPS, RTT, buffer), מדדי עסקים (Bet, GGR, Hold).
פרוטוקולי רשת והפעלות
וידאו:- WebRTC - Latency (100-500 ms), ICE/STUN/TURN.
- HLS/LL-HLS - עיכוב גבוה יותר, אך פשוט יותר CDN.
- הימורים ואירועים: WebSocket/HTTP-SSE/REST.
- Tokens: קצר ימים JWT/Opaque (TTL 3-10 דקות), סיבוב לפי בקשת הספק.
דוגמניות ארנק
1) ארנק ללא תפרים (מומלץ)
ההימור/התשלום עובר דרך הגשר לארנק של המפעיל.
יתרונות: איזון מאוחד, בקרת הגבלה מיידית, ר "ג מפושטת.
חסרונות: ארנק קפדני מזמין (SLA) דרישות.
2) ארנק העברה
השחקן מעביר כספים ל ”בנק השולחן” אצל הספק.
מקצוענים: פחות עומס על הארנק של המפעיל בפסגות.
חסרונות: החזרות קשות יותר, התפייסות ושליטה ב-AML, חיכוך ב-UX.
מחזור חיים מופעל (חלק)
1 ./CreatSession bridge יוצר את ” Id', מחזיר את” Mover Url ”,” bet Socketurl'.
2. החזית פותחת את הנגן (WebRTC/HLS) ואת חיבור האירוע.
3. השחקן מהמר על "obserBet" בברידג '("idempottweather Key", "doutId'," selection "," stock ").
4. ברידג 'מאשר מראש את הסכום (hold) בארנק.
5. הספק מכריז ”בטוחות סגורות” = ספין/דיל.
6. Bridge מחשב את התשלום, כותב את ההחזקה/החזרה, יוצר "transActionId'.
7. Bridge שולח webhook לפלטפורמה (”doutId',” תוצאה ”,” payout', ” After”), כותב לספר החשבונות.
8. סיום/חיבור מחדש - על ידי ' Id' (idempotent).
חוזה אירועים (דוגמה)
□ קצב גשר (WS/REST):ג 'סון
{
"סוג": "bet. place", "idempoott sess_abc123, Key": "c0a4-77f"..., "R-2025-10-17-18:45:03-Table23, Id':" [ ":" selection ":" ] ". 00, ”מטבע”: ”EUR”, ”פרופיל ”: ”VIP _ A”
}
תגובת גשר:
ג 'סון
{
"מעמד ": "מקובל", " Hold':"" - 5. 00, ”betId':” בית _ 9f2 ”...,” Limits': (”MaxBet”: ”5000”. 00"}
}
תוצאה של סיבוב הרציף (webhook):
ג 'סון
{
"אירוע ":" סיבוב. פשרה, "adid':" R-2025-10-17-18: 45: 03-Table23 "," הימורים ": [
”BetId':” בית _ 9f2 ”...,” יתד ”:” 5. 00, ”תשלום ”:” 180”. 00, ”תוצאה”: ”WIN”
], ”עסקאות”: [
”trn _ bet _ 9f2”..., ”סוג”: ”DEBIT”, ”כמות”: ”5”. 00”, ”id': ”trn _ pay _ 9f2 ”..., ”סוג ”:” CREDIT”,” סכום”:” 180”. 00"}
, " אחרי":" 1320. 40"
}
כללי מפתח:
- כל הבקשות עם 'IdempootsKey'.
- הקלדה ברורה של תוצאות: ”WIN/LOSE/PUSH/VOID/RETRY”.
- זיהוי יציב: "doutId' הוא ייחודי גלובלית (טבלה + זמן + רסיס).
קטלוג ומגבלות
תגלית: ”/spects/id/tables ”- רשימת שולחנות, גבולות, הימורים צדדיים, שפות, לוח זמנים.
בריכות הגבלה: ”ברירת מחדל”, ”VIP _ A”, ”VIP _ B”, ”Ultra”.
Country/KYC status mapping rules.
שינוי גבול חם: ”גבולות” אירועים. עדכון בלי לאתחל את השולחן.
תצפית זרם ואיכות (QOS)
מדדים על ידי שחקן:- RTT של אותות הימור (המטרה <150 ms WebRTC).
- הורידו מסגרות/אירועים חוצץ.
- התאמת סיביות/רזולוציה.
- הימור חלון Latency (זמן בין 'betmous Open' וקבלה בפועל של ההימור).
- למעלה של השולחן, סיבובים בוטלו, יישובים מאוחרים, תדר ”ריק”.
- זמן ממוצע להסדר לאחר סגירת התעריפים.
- התראות QOS: הידלדלות FPS, 'retry' קוצים.
ציות ובטיחות
KYT/AML: ניתוח של מקורות הפקדה, ”סיכון גבוה” דגל איסור על הימורים חיים.
ר.ג. (משחק אחראי): פסקי זמן, גבולות, הרחקה עצמית
תושבות נתונים: לוגיקה ומח "ש מאוחסנים על ידי המפעיל; ברידג 'מאחסן רק את בולי העץ והצבירים.
אבטחת תחבורה: mTLS/IP-whitelist לספקים, חתימת בקשת HMAC, אסימוני TTL קצרים.
ביקורת: ספר חשבונות בלתי ניתן לשינוי (WORM/append-only), יצוא על ידי 'doutId'/' Id'.
התיישבות, השלמה וחזרה
פשרה על-לטוס: חיוב מיידי/אשראי לכל תוצאה.
התפייסות: פיוס של דיווחי ספק (שעה/יום) עם ספר הגשר (P&L, commission).
תרחישי VOID/REUND: כשל זרם, טעות סוחר, מחלוקת - חזרה חלקית/מלאה עם קודי סיבה ברורים.
מרכז מחלוקת: חבורה של 'roundId' ↔ להקליט וידאו (timecode) כך שתמיכה פותרת כרטיסים במהירות.
ביצועים וסובלנות אשמה
הגדלה: מתאם ספק חסר מעמד + קפקא/NATS כאוטובוס אירועים.
אחסון: חם (Redis) עבור הפעלות/מגבלות, חם (Postgres) עבור ספר חשבונות, קר (S3) עבור יומנים.
פולבקים: אם הארנק אינו עונה - ”Soft _ Secure” עם retras; אם הספק אינו זמין - לכבות את השולחנות/להסתיר בלובי.
מגשים אחוריים: זה בטוח לחזור על ”backyBet ”/” ליישב” על גבי פסקי זמן רשת.
UX: תבניות חזיתיות
סינכרון שעון: השתמש 'ServerTime' מגשר עבור 'Close הימורים דרך' טיימרים..
לוקליזציה: localization: language deface interface lan הצג כתוביות/גלוסרי של מונחים.
נגן זרם: auto-fallback WebRTC # LL-HLS עם רשת גרועה.
שגיאה UI: נקה קודים (”LBRG-401 ”, LBRG-503.
שולחן מרובה: טבלאות החלפה מהירות מבלי לשבור את ההפעלה (שימוש חוזר ב " Id').
אנטי דפוסים
לאחסן אסימונים ארוכים על הלקוח.
קבלו הצעה לאחר 'betslady סגור' בשל עסקה - מחלוקת מובטחת.
היעדר מפתח Idempottweather "* שכפולים במגשים חוזרים.
לערבב אזורי זמן ב 'RoundId' ודיווחים.
קבע גבולות ”בעין” ללא פרופילים וסטטוס KYC.
התעלם מהזרם QOS - כווץ גבוה ברשתות סלולריות.
תוכנית יישום צעד אחר צעד (רשימה)
ארכיטקטורה וחוזים
[ ] תקן חוזה אירוע אחד: 'בטא. מקום', 'הימור. מקובל, 'הימור. נדחה, עגול. ליישב ”,” גבולות. עדכון, פגישה. קרוב ”, ספק”. שגיאה ".
[ ] מגדיר אידמפוטנטיות ופורמטים "doutId'," betId', "transactionId'.
[ ] בחר את מודל הארנק (עדיפות עליונה).
בטיחות
[ ] mTLS לספקים, HMAC חתימת ספרי אינטרנט, TTL אסימון רישום 10 דקות.
[ ] מדיניות RG/AML/KYT לפני הכניסה לשיעורים, רישום ביקורת.
קטלוג ומגבלות
[ ] טבלאות ייבוא והגבלת פרופילים, מיפוי על ידי מדינה/מטבע/ACC.
[ ] עדכון חם של גבולות ומדינות שולחן.
פרונטנד
[ ] נגן WebRTC עם LL-HLS folback, שעון סינכרון, טיימר הימור יציב.
[ ] קודי שגיאה והודעות ניתנות לקריאה.
תוכנית בדיקה
[ ] תסריטי איחור/אובדן מנות, חיבור מחדש מבלי להפסיד במכרז.
[ ] Lick Double Click Bettle # חיוב אחד (idempotency).
[ ] VOID/החזר, סיבובים שנויים במחלוקת, סתירות בדיווחים.
יכולת תצפית
[ ] ARTT, מסגרות בוטלו, סיבובים, זמן להסדר.
[ התראות ] על ידי ספק SLA, להתפייס דיווחים.
גשר הופך את גן החיות לשילוב חי למערכת מנוהלת: תעריפים אחידים, חישובים אחידים, עם גשר מתוכנן כהלכה, המפעיל מחבר ספקים חיים חדשים מהר יותר, מפחית סיכונים טכנולוגיים ומגן על P&L באמצעות אידמפוטנטיות, מגבלות קפדניות ויכולת תצפית ברורה.